Sec. 659.148. FEES.

(a)The state campaign manager or any local campaign manager appointed by the state policy committee may not charge a fee to the comptroller, a state agency, or a state employee for the services the state campaign manager or local campaign manager provides in connection with a state employee charitable campaign.
(b)The state campaign manager may charge a reasonable and necessary fee for actual campaign expenses in an amount authorized by the state policy committee to the participating charitable organizations in the same proportion that the contributions to that charitable organization bear to the total of contributions in the state employee charitable campaign. Legislative History

Added by Acts 1995, 74th Leg., ch. 76, Sec. 5.17(a), eff. Sept. 1, 1995. Amended by Acts 1997, 75th Leg., ch. 1035, Sec. 39, eff. June 19, 1997. Amended by: Acts 2013, 83rd Leg., R.S., Ch. 1315 (S.B. 217 ), Sec. 12, eff. September 1, 2013.
